Transaction 73e139fd3502f124b4a637b5f9cce27d254e29d40f839d070ea475b4f56157f6

4 Input
2 Outputs
  • 73e139fd3502f124b4a637b5f9cce27d254e29d40f839d070ea475b4f56157f6:0
  • value  17500000
    address  3NF9hGY9TJRf81XeLLDUoAp3AkQDW5amSU
  • 73e139fd3502f124b4a637b5f9cce27d254e29d40f839d070ea475b4f56157f6:1
  • value  54531
    address  bc1qden7sxzrw9vmmdxedpghxsaadn7mhz7kxss4nd